  • Neat trailer jacks.

    I got the new Handyman mag the other day and they showed these jacks so I went online to check them out. Pretty cool. They look easy to use and are pretty light. Here is the links but I would shop around more as I dont really want to promote these sites because I never bought anything from them. Just I found they had the jacks.....

    I checked out the reviews and as long as you dont have low hanging fenders the reviews are good on the tandem axle EX Jack. Also doubles as a wheel chock.
    EZ trailer jack for tandem axle trailers

    The reviews on this single axle jack was good unless you have torsion axle. It says right in the description it wont work with torsion axles.
